#pragma once
#include <mutex>
#include "Module.h"
#include "tptimer.h"
#include "libIARM.h"
namespace WPEFramework {
namespace Plugin {
class FrameRate : public PluginHost::IPlugin, public PluginHost::JSONRPC {
private:
// We do not allow this plugin to be copied !!
FrameRate(const FrameRate&) = delete;
FrameRate& operator=(const FrameRate&) = delete;
//Begin methods
uint32_t setCollectionFrequencyWrapper(const JsonObject& parameters, JsonObject& response);
uint32_t startFpsCollectionWrapper(const JsonObject& parameters, JsonObject& response);
uint32_t stopFpsCollectionWrapper(const JsonObject& parameters, JsonObject& response);
uint32_t updateFpsWrapper(const JsonObject& parameters, JsonObject& response);
uint32_t setFrmMode(const JsonObject& parameters, JsonObject& response);
uint32_t getFrmMode(const JsonObject& parameters, JsonObject& response);
uint32_t getDisplayFrameRate(const JsonObject& parameters, JsonObject& response);
uint32_t setDisplayFrameRate(const JsonObject& parameters, JsonObject& response);
//End methods
int getCollectionFrequency();
void setCollectionFrequency(int frequencyInMs);
bool startFpsCollection();
bool stopFpsCollection();
void updateFps(int newFpsValue);
void fpsCollectionUpdate( int averageFps, int minFps, int maxFps );
virtual void enableFpsCollection() {}
virtual void disableFpsCollection() {}
void onReportFpsTimer();
void onReportFpsTimerTest();
void InitializeIARM();
void DeinitializeIARM();
void frameRatePreChange(char *displayFrameRate);
static void FrameRatePreChange(const char *owner, IARM_EventId_t eventId, void *data, size_t len);
void frameRatePostChange(char *displayFrameRate);
static void FrameRatePostChange(const char *owner, IARM_EventId_t eventId, void *data, size_t len);
public:
FrameRate();
virtual ~FrameRate();
virtual const string Initialize(PluginHost::IShell* service) override;
virtual void Deinitialize(PluginHost::IShell* service) override;
virtual string Information() const override;
BEGIN_INTERFACE_MAP(FrameRate)
INTERFACE_ENTRY(PluginHost::IPlugin)
INTERFACE_ENTRY(PluginHost::IDispatcher)
END_INTERFACE_MAP
public:
static FrameRate* _instance;
private:
int m_fpsCollectionFrequencyInMs;
int m_minFpsValue;
int m_maxFpsValue;
int m_totalFpsValues;
int m_numberOfFpsUpdates;
bool m_fpsCollectionInProgress;
//QTimer m_reportFpsTimer;
TpTimer m_reportFpsTimer;
int m_lastFpsValue;
std::mutex m_callMutex;
};
} // namespace Plugin
} // namespace WPEFramework
